#5e28c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5e28c8 is composed of 36.9% red, 15.7%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53% cyan, 80%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 260.3 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 47.1%. #5e28c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#bc50ff with #000091.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#5e28c8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020104 is the darkest color, while #f6f3f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5e28c8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#76727e is the less saturated color, while #5203ed is the most saturated one.
